	function fnLogin() {		
		//alert(1);
		if (field_validation()) {
			document.frmLogin.submit();
		}
	}
	
	function fnSubmit() {	
		var str_email;
		str_email = document.frmForgot.txt_email.value;
		if (str_email.search(/(\S+)@(\S+)\.(\S+)/) == -1)
 		{
			alert('Please enter a valid email address.');
			document.frmForgot.txt_email.focus();
		} 		
		else
		{
			document.frmForgot.hdn_email.value = str_email;
			document.frmForgot.submit();		
		}
	}
	
	function field_validation() {
		var str_id;
		var str_pass;
		str_id = document.frmLogin.txt_id.value;
		str_pass = document.frmLogin.txt_pass.value;
				
		//********** Field Validation *************
		if (str_id == '')
		{
			alert('Please enter your user ID.');
			document.frmLogin.txt_id.focus();
			return false;
		}
		else if (str_pass == '')
		{
			alert('Please enter your password.');
			document.frmLogin.txt_pass.focus();
			return false;
		}		
		else
		{
			document.frmLogin.hdn_id.value = str_id;
			document.frmLogin.hdn_pass.value = str_pass;
			return true;		
		}
	}	
			
	function enterEvent() {
		if (event.keyCode == 13) {
			fnLogin();
		}
	}
	
	function trim(str) {
		return str.replace(/\s/g, "");
	}
		
